Skip to main content

Joshi Spotlight: Legendary Goddess I-II & Wrestlemarinepiad Recap

LEGENDARY GODDESS I- TAKAKO INOUE: * So the “Legendary Goddess” tapes are an octet of VHS releases at the tail end of 1993, each about an hour long, featuring a spotlight on one particular AJW wrestler. The top eight stars of the company at the time each had their own, with the UWA Tag Champs ... Read more

from Scotts Blog of Doom!